About 7 Adrian Crescent
7 Adrian Crescent is a detached house in Sheffield (S5 8EA). It has a recorded floor area of 98 m² (around 1055 sq ft) and construction records dating it to 2020. The latest certificate (April 2022) returns a B (score 84), comfortably above the UK average. The recommended improvements would push it to A (score 95).
Across 2022–2023, sale prices on this property compounded at 7.9%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£263,000 is 16.1% above the 2023 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£215/sq ft) was about 32.3%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Most recent transfer: March 2023 at £226,500.
